Use of optical images to authenticate and enable a return with an electronic receipt
First Claim
1. At a mobile electronic device, the mobile electronic device including a processor, system memory, and a camera, a method for returning a purchased item at a store location, the method comprising:
- opening electronic receipts software in response to user input, the electronic receipts software including item return functionality for selecting items for return at store locations, the return functionality disabled upon opening the electronic receipts software;
selecting an electronic receipt stored on the mobile electronic device in response to additional user input, the electronic receipt identifying one or more purchased items;
capturing a machine readable code via the camera, the machine readable code associated with a returns POS terminal at the store location;
the processor analyzing the machine readable code to determine that the mobile electronic device is in the vicinity of a returns POS terminal;
enabling the return functionality of the electronic receipts software in response to determining that the mobile electronic device is in the vicinity of the returns POS terminal;
selecting at least one item for return at the store location in response to further user input subsequent to enabling the return functionality, the at least one item selected from among the identified one or more purchased items;
indicating the selected at least one item for entry at the returns POS terminal; and
receiving an updated electronic receipt, the updated electronic receipt representing the status of the at least one item as returned.

Abstract
A method is disclosed for authenticating and enabling returns at a physical store location and based off of an electronic receipt. The electronic receipt may be viewed on a mobile electronic device with electronic receipts software thereon. The electronic receipts software may use machine readable codes to verify whether a customer is present at a returns terminal at a physical store location. More particularly, the electronic receipts software may contain a bar code reader module and use the camera of the mobile electronic device to capture a machine readable code such as a bar code or QR code. The electronics receipts software may recover data from the machine readable code which identifies the store, retail location, etc. This information may be compared against known values to determine that the customer is present at a returns terminal.
